Open Saturday 6 June 11:00 am Auction Saturday 20 June 11:00 amDeveloped in the late 1960s and early 1970s as part of the Belconnen district expansion. The suburb was designed with a focus on family living, featuring large residential blocks and integrated green belts. It reflects the mid-century planning ideals of the National Capital Development Commission.
Scullin is currently undergoing a generational shift as original owners sell to young professional families attracted by the suburb's proximity to Hawker and the Belconnen CBD.

Standard home security is sufficient; focus on securing side gates and garages which are common targets for opportunistic theft.
The primary risks are structural and regulatory rather than environmental. Asbestos and energy efficiency are the main financial hurdles for buyers.
Very Low; suburb is elevated and well-drained by the ACT stormwater network.
Low; however, properties on the western fringe should maintain basic defensible space.
Standard premiums apply; no significant loading for flood or fire in this zone.
RZ2 Suburban Core (Medium Density) near the local shops and transport corridors.
Streets immediately surrounding the Scullin Shops and those with RZ2 classification.
RZ2 zoning allows for 'manor houses' or dual-occupancies, which can significantly increase the underlying land value but may change the street's character.

A stable, maturing suburb with a notable increase in high-income professional couples with young children.
The high owner-occupancy rate and rising income levels support property maintenance and community investment.
Development is largely restricted to small-scale residential infill and shopfront upgrades.
Residents value the suburb for its peace, safety, and the 'hidden gem' quality of its local shops. It is widely regarded as a friendly, unpretentious place to raise children.
